Understanding the Function and Maintenance of Throttle Body Cables in Vehicles


Understanding the Throttle Body Cable Function, Importance, and Maintenance


The throttle body cable is a critical component in many automotive systems, playing a vital role in how vehicles operate. This slender yet essential cable connects the accelerator pedal to the throttle body, facilitating the control of air intake into the engine. A seamless interaction between the driver’s intention and the engine’s response is made possible through this connection. In this article, we will delve into the function, importance, and maintenance of the throttle body cable, and explore its impact on vehicle performance.


Function of the Throttle Body Cable


The throttle body cable serves as a conduit for the driver's input when accelerating the vehicle. When a driver presses down on the accelerator pedal, the cable is pulled, which in turn opens the throttle plate within the throttle body. This action allows more air to enter the engine, mixing with the fuel and ultimately resulting in increased power output. The effectiveness of this system is vital for smooth acceleration and overall vehicle performance.


In modern vehicles, this traditional cable operation has largely been replaced by electronic throttle control systems (ETC), which use sensors and actuators instead of a physical cable. However, many older models still rely on the mechanical throttle body cable, making understanding its function essential for both drivers and mechanics.


Importance of the Throttle Body Cable


The throttle body cable is significant for several reasons


1. Direct Control It offers a direct mechanical link between the accelerator pedal and the throttle body, allowing for instant feedback and responsiveness. This direct connection contributes to a more engaging driving experience.


2. Driver Confidence A properly functioning throttle body cable enhances driver confidence. When a driver presses the accelerator, they expect an immediate response from the vehicle. Any delay or malfunction can lead to frustration or, in some cases, unsafe driving conditions.


3. Engine Performance The efficiency of the throttle body cable directly influences engine performance. A well-maintained cable ensures that the throttle opens and closes precisely, optimizing air intake and fuel combustion. This can lead to better fuel economy and reduced emissions.

4. Cost-Effectiveness Compared to more advanced electronic systems, mechanical throttle body cables are generally easier and more cost-effective to repair or replace. This accessibility makes them a practical choice for many older vehicle models.


Maintenance of the Throttle Body Cable


Maintaining the throttle body cable is essential for ensuring longevity and reliability. Here are some tips for proper maintenance


1. Regular Inspections Conduct visual inspections of the throttle body cable for any signs of wear, fraying, or damage. Look for signs of rust or corrosion, especially in exposed areas.


2. Lubrication Periodically lubricate the cable to reduce friction and ensure smooth operation. A suitable lubricant can help protect against wear and extend the cable's lifespan.


3. Adjustment Ensure that the throttle body cable is properly adjusted. Many vehicles have an adjustment mechanism that allows for precise calibration. A cable that is too loose or too tight can lead to diminished performance and potential damage.


4. Replacement If any signs of wear or malfunction are detected, it’s advisable to replace the throttle body cable promptly. A malfunctioning cable can lead to severe engine issues and affect driving safety.
